Battlefield 3 Armored Kill, the third downloadable content pack for first-person shooter game Battlefield 3, will deploy on Sept. 4, according to game studio Dice’s official schedule.
PlayStation 3 players who subscribe to the game’s Premium package will gain early access to the new DLC that day, while PC and Xbox 360 Premium users can catch the launch on Sept 11th.
The game continues its rollout on Sept. 18, when all PlayStation 3 owners can download Armored Kill, followed by Xbox 360 and PC gamers on Sept 25th.
Prepare for some serious high-speed destruction. This expansion features new drivable tanks, ATVs, mobile artillery and more. Plus, it delivers huge battlefields for an all-out vehicle assault, including the biggest map in Battlefield history.
Take on a tough new mode. It’s time to bring out the heavy artillery in the new Tank Superiority mode. Achieve your mission objectives in massive battle tanks and hard-hitting tank destroyers.
